42-16106. Hearing A. The county board shall act on the petition, shall hear testimony presented in person at the hearing and may subpoena witnesses to testify regarding the petition. Unless all parties agree otherwise, each party shall submit evidence in person. B. The petitioner shall pay the cost of producing the petitioner's witnesses at the hearing. C. The assessor or the assessor's designated representative shall: 1. Attend all meetings and hearings of the county board. 2. Supply the board with all information that the assessor possesses.
